O R D E R
This criminal original petition has been filed to modify the condition imposed in C.M.P.No.4091 of 2016 by order dated 22.07.2016 by the learned Judicial Magistrate No.3, Erode.
2. Heard the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ner and the learned Additional Public Prosecutor appearing for the respondent.
3. This petitioner was arrested by the respondent police in Crime No.861 of 2015 for various offences under Sections 4(1-A) 4(aaa) r/w 4(1-A) 4(1)(b)(g) of TNP Act 1937 and Section 5,6,7 of TNRS Rules and Section 420, 467, 468, 471, 212 of IPC and he was granted bail on 22.07.2016 by the Judicial Magistrate No.III, Erode, in C.M.P.No.4091 of 2016 on condition that he should report before the respondent police at 10.00am every day for 30 days.

4. It is seen that this petitioner was arrested in various crime numbers and he has been granted bails by various Courts and he was detained under the Goondas Act. Ultimately, he was released on bail only on 15.09.2016 but, he is unable to comply with the condition imposed in this case.
5. Under such circumstances, the condition imposed by the Judicial Magistrate No.III, Erode, is hereby modified to the effect that the petitioner should report before the respondent police for a period of one week (i.e.) from 16.10.2016 to 23.10.2016 and thereafter, as and when required. Rest of the conditions imposed by the Judicial Magistrate No.III, Erode, are maintained.
6. If the petitioner fails to appear before the Court without sufficient cause, after having been released on bail in accordance with the terms of the bail order, a fresh prosecution can be initiated against him under Section 229-A IPC. With the above said directions, the criminal original petition is disposed of.
